Transitioning out of that Xamarin framework into the .NET MAUI framework : What Developers Must understand

The shift away from Xamarin represents a major change for many .NET programmers . While Xamarin allowed for building cross-platform handheld applications, Microsoft's attention has moved into .NET MAUI. This updated framework delivers a consolidated approach for targeting several environments , including Android, iOS, Windows, and macOS. Crucial distinctions encompass a reduced architecture, enhanced performance, and a more standardized development workflow. Developers should anticipate a familiarization curve as they transition their existing skills to the .NET MAUI ecosystem.
